Mourinho hurts leg after awkward collision with United's James

OLI SCARFF / AFP / Getty

Jose Mourinho appeared to pick up an injury during his first visit to Old Trafford since Manchester United fired him last season.

The Tottenham manager was in visible pain following a Harry Winks challenge that resulted in Daniel James colliding headfirst into Mourinho on the touchline.

James was left writhing in pain after appearing to strike the side of Mourinho's knee with his head.

Winks was shown a yellow card for his challenge on the United winger, while Mourinho was seen limping after the collision.

Mourinho, who United sacked in December 2018, was hired to replace Mauricio Pochettino as Spurs manager last month.
